Liberal broadband plan is cheaper and faster
The Chief Executive of Telstra, David Thodey, is quoted in the media today (20 April) saying that the Liberal Party’s broadband model is faster and cheaper to roll out than the $36 billion design being pursued by Labor (link to article below). Mr Thodey is quoted as saying: “Definitely fibre to the node is a faster and cheaper deployment.” [...] Continue reading » » »
